Double Bachelor's degree in Artificial Intelligence and Organizational Sciences - Bachelor’s Year 1

Program Objectives

Artificial intelligence and the collection and processing of big data are impacting all business sectors. To satisfy the need to train decision-makers who are acclimated to the digital revolution, able to understand the issues and use the tools, Université Paris Dauphine – PSL is introducing an innovative double Bachelor's degree in “Artificial Intelligence and Organizational Sciences”, with its first class entering in fall 2022.

The double Bachelor's degree is a rigorous multidisciplinary program combining economics, management, mathematics, data science, computer science and English. After three years, this program culminates in a dual diploma with a Bachelor’s degree in applied economics and a Bachelor's degree in organizational computer science, offering access to several Master's degree programs at the university.

Aside from the hands-on modules for manipulating data and algorithms, the program includes reflexive teaching of the uses and issues of artificial intelligence, particularly on the ethical issues raised by the digital revolution. Université Paris Dauphine – PSL is one of the very first universities to include a class on ecological issue awareness in the first year of the Bachelor's degree.

Program objectives:

The program is based on fundamental courses from the Bachelor's degree in Mathematics-Computer Science and the Bachelor's degree in Organizational Sciences, and also includes new courses.

  • Manipulating data and algorithms.
  • Understanding the origin and significance of data.
  • Assessing the implications of data and their regulatory and societal impacts.
  • Developing solid data science and artificial intelligence skills along with knowledge of their use and impact in society.
  • Acquiring core knowledge in mathematics, computer science, statistics, economics, management and accounting.
  • Introducing students to the corporate world and the economic environment.
  • Supporting students in their awareness of contemporary issues, in terms of digital transformation and climate change.
  • Successfully integrating students into university life by supporting their transition from secondary to higher education.

The double Bachelor's degree in Artificial Intelligence and Organizational Sciences is part of the Dauphine Digital research program. It mobilizes all of the university’s disciplines and research laboratories in Organizational Sciences and Mathematics-Computer Science.
Dauphine Digital also relies on the Interdisciplinary Institute of Artificial Intelligence (known as PR[AI]RIE) through Université PSL.
